Embrace this life before you...

Embrace this life before you,
As it will not always lay ahead-
It will change come every twist & turn,
Until your days are spent.

So embrace your family,
Embrace your friends,
For it is those who'll make the journey,
Worthwhile in the end.

Unfold those wings, always fly free,
Whether your crossing life's next hurdle,
Over be it- Land or sea.
Engulf in everything new along the way,
Take it all unto its greatest depth-
Come whatever may.

As if each new awakening,
Is the beginning of your last day.
